How Common Is The Last Name Orálek? popularity and diffusion

The last name Orálek is the 1,098,270th most numerous last name world-wide It is held by approximately 1 in 32,679,578 people. The surname Orálek is mostly found in Europe, where 99 percent of Orálek live; 99 percent live in Eastern Europe and 99 percent live in West Slavic Europe.

Orálek is most commonly occurring in Czechia, where it is held by 217 people, or 1 in 49,002. In Czechia Orálek is primarily concentrated in: South Moravian Region, where 37 percent live, Olomouc Region, where 25 percent live and Moravian-Silesian Region, where 14 percent live. Apart from Czechia Orálek occurs in 3 countries. It also occurs in Slovakia, where 2 percent live and South Korea, where 0 percent live.
